You have a few options here, regardless of team. The WCHA has its own subscription streaming service now, and depending on where you live, you should be able to get some games on TV as well. NBCSN usually has a couple Notre Dame games per month, and while they're not all that great this year, they play some really good teams in Hockey East. Fox Sports [location] channels around the Midwest usually has games, and Big Ten Network shows a game or two per week. If you're out east, regional networks like NESN and some of the local cable channels should have games as well.

drat near every team also has a radio affiliate. Many of them are the on-campus station so quality can really vary, but it's better than nothing.

The CHN Live Scoreboard does a great job listing what games are on radio and TV, and is a really great website overall in terms of stats, schedules, info, etc.

As far as teams, BOWLING GREEN, I can't really suggest BGSU anyone, but here's FALCONS, BITCH a quick 'n dirty conference breakdown BOWLING GREEN of the conferences to give you a feel for things:

Atlantic Hockey - Probably the weakest of the conferences. Currently topped by Robert Morris, having a better-than-expected year. Has the two hockey-playing service schools (Air Force, Army) if you dig that.

Big Ten - One good team (Minnesota), a few teams that used to be good (Michigan State, Michigan, Wisconsin), one brand new team (Penn State), and gently caress Ohio State.

ECAC - Smart-rear end nerd hockey. This is basically the Ivy League + a few others, and most of the others are pretty solid teams. Good teams include current national champion Union, political polling school Quinnipiac (they're actually pretty good), and Colgate.

Hockey East - Top to bottom, probably the strongest conference in college hockey. Pretty much anyone in the top 6 can be a legit national title contender. The conference tournament always has great matchups, so if you're out east, keep an eye on it.

NCHC - Small but mighty conference. Great Miami midwest/western teams including Miami North Dakota, St. Cloud, and Miami Denver. Western Michigan can be kind of hit-and-miss and Colorado College is usually weak Miami but everyone else Miami is good.
You're welcome, OYM and Miamikid :v:

WCHA - Sort of the Island of Misfit Toys of conferences. The WCHA makes zero goddamn sense geographically (Two Alaskan teams, one in Alabama, potential future home for Arizona State because why the hell not?) but has started to really find an identity and turn into something solid. The Fightin' Nerds of Michigan Tech have had a phenomenal start to the year behind some great goaltending, Minnesota State is usually on top, BGSU has experienced a renaissance over the last 2 years and is finally back in the national picture, MOTHER loving ATOMIC SPACE BEARS, and Ferris State makes the national tournament pretty often as well.
